UnityYAMLMerge fails to merge on some computers when some specific files are used
How to reproduce:
1. Extract the attached “LaptopPC.zip“
2. Run the Command Prompt as administrator
3. In the Command Prompt, navigate to the folder where “LaptopPC.zip“ was extracted
4. In the Command Prompt, enter DoEverything.bat and execute it
5. Follow the instructions in the Command prompt
Expected result: After “replay_merge.bat” is run, the MergeTool window appears
Actual result: After “replay_merge.bat” is run, the MergeTool window does not appear, and the result_replay.asset is empty
Reproducible with: 6000.0.61f1, 6000.1.0a1, 6000.2.11f1, 6000.3.0b9, 6000.4.0a4
Not reproducible on: 2023.1.0a1, 6000.0.23f1 (1c4764c07fb4)
Reproducible on: Windows 11
Not reproducible on: No other environment tested
Notes:
- Make sure Perforce is installed
- The issue reproduces only on some computers, even with the same Perforce version
